Lillie Maude Collins Bonsall, 77, died October 23, 2001 in Royersford Veteran's Home almost 9 months to the day that her sweetheart Joe died. She was born to Gertrude Otley Spence and Kenny Monroe Collins January 24, 1924. She married Joseph Sloan Bonsall on April 2, 1946 in a military wedding. Lillie Maude and Joe were married for 55 years and lived most of those years at 3517 Jasper Street in Philadelphia, PA. She and Joe had two children, Joseph Sloan Bonsall Jr. and Nancy Bonsall.

She was preceded in death by her parents; her husband; one sister Blanche Washington; and five brothers, Frank Monroe, Paul Clifton, James Thomas, John Pershing, and William Sterling Collins. She is survived by her son Joseph Sloan Bonsall Jr.; a daughter Nancy Bonsall; and three grandchildren; and two brothers Sidney Cairey Collins of Greensboro, NC and Lewis Monroe Collins and wife Immogene of Roanoke Rapids, NC .
